stm32g4外部管脚特性
时间: 2023-09-07 20:13:47 浏览: 49
STM32G4系列微控制器的外部管脚具有以下特性:
1. 通用输入输出口(GPIO):STM32G4微控制器提供了多个GPIO引脚,可以作为通用输入或输出使用。每个引脚可以配置为不同的功能,如数字输入、数字输出、模拟输入等。
2. 电源和地引脚:外部供电和地引脚用于连接电源和地。通常有多个电源引脚和地引脚可供选择,以满足不同电源和地的需求。
3. 外设接口引脚:STM32G4系列微控制器提供了多个外设接口引脚,用于连接各种外设模块。这些引脚可以配置为不同的接口类型,如SPI、I2C、USART、CAN等。
4. 模拟引脚:模拟引脚用于连接模拟外设,如模数转换器(ADC)、数模转换器(DAC)等。这些引脚具有特殊的模拟特性,需要注意其电气特性和连接方式。
5. 中断引脚:外部中断引脚用于连接外部中断源,可以触发中断事件。这些引脚具有中断触发功能,可以配置为上升沿触发、下降沿触发等。
6. 调试和编程接口引脚:STM32G4微控制器提供了调试和编程接口引脚,用于连接调试器和编程器,以进行调试和烧录程序。
以上是STM32G4系列微控制器外部管脚的一些特性。具体的管脚定义和功能可以参考相关的技术文档和数据手册,以确保正确使用和连接外部引脚。
相关问题
stm32g4的opamp使用
STM32G4系列微控制器具有内置的运算放大器(OPAMP)模块,可用于模拟电路设计和信号处理应用。下面是如何使用STM32G4的OPAMP模块的一般步骤:
1. 配置OPAMP模块:首先,您需要配置OPAMP模块的参数,包括增益、输入和输出模式、功耗模式等。您可以使用相关的寄存器和位字段来完成这些配置。具体的寄存器和位字段名称可以在相关的数据手册中找到。
2. 配置输入通道:选择要连接到OPAMP的输入通道。STM32G4微控制器通常具有多个可用于连接到OPAMP的输入通道,例如模拟输入引脚、DAC输出等。您可以使用GPIO配置寄存器来设置这些输入通道。
3. 连接反馈回路:根据您的应用需求,选择合适的反馈回路连接方式,例如非反相放大器、反相放大器等。通过设置OPAMP的相关控制位来选择反馈回路连接方式。
4. 启用OPAMP:在配置完OPAMP后,使用相应的寄存器位来启用OPAMP模块。这将使OPAMP开始工作并处理输入信号。
5. 外部电路连接:根据您的应用需求,连接适当的外部电路到OPAMP引脚。这可能包括电阻、电容等元件,以及信号源和负载等。
请注意,具体的OPAMP使用方法可能因不同的STM32G4型号而有所变化。因此,建议您参考相关的STM32G4系列微控制器的数据手册和参考手册以获取更详细的信息和具体的代码示例。
STM32G0B1RE引脚介绍
STM32G0B1RE是一款低功耗、高性能的32位微控制器,它有48个引脚,其中包括:
1. GPIO引脚:共有27个GPIO引脚,可以用于输出和输入数字信号。
2. 外部中断引脚:共有16个外部中断引脚,可以用于检测外部事件,并触发中断。
3. 串口引脚:共有3个串口引脚,包括2个USART和1个LPUART,可以用于串行通信。
4. SPI引脚:共有2个SPI引脚,可以用于高速串行通信。
5. I2C引脚:共有2个I2C引脚,可以用于短距离的串行通信。
6. ADC引脚:共有2个ADC引脚,可以用于模拟信号的转换。
7. DAC引脚:共有1个DAC引脚,可以用于数字信号的模拟输出。
8. PWM引脚:共有4个PWM引脚,可以用于产生脉冲宽度调制信号。
9. 比较器引脚:共有2个比较器引脚,可以用于比较两个输入信号的大小。
10. USB引脚:共有1个USB引脚,可以用于USB通信。
总之,STM32G0B1RE的引脚非常丰富,可以满足各种应用的需求。